Helen T Crosby 1874–1940 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 17 Jul 1874

Birth Location: County Meath, Ireland

Death Date: 5 Jul 1940

Death Location: 8 Elko St., Boston, Suffolk, Massachusetts, USA

Father: Patrick Crosby

Mother: Alice McArdle

Spouse(s): Thomas Reilly

Children(s): Thomas Reilly

In 1874, Helen T Crosby entered the world in County Meath, Ireland, born to Patrick Crosby And Alice Mcardle. Helen T Crosby married Thomas J Reilly, and had children including Thomas J Reilly. Helen T Crosby passed away in 1940 in 8 Elko St., Boston, Suffolk, Massachusetts, USA.
